Two rain drops falling through air have radii in the ratio 1: 2. They will have terminal velocity in the ratio
1. 1: 2
2. 4: 1
3. 1: 4
4. 2: 1

SOLUTION:
Correct option is 3.
Two rain drops falling through air have radii in the ratio 1: 2. They will have terminal velocity in the ratio \underline{1: 4}.
Explanation:
\begin{array}{l} V \propto r^{2} \\ \frac{V_{1}}{V}=\left(\frac{1}{2}\right)^{2}=\frac{1}{4} \end{array}
